Bourns provides a recommended PCB layout and land pattern in their application notes and design guides. It's essential to follow these guidelines to ensure proper thermal management, signal integrity, and reliability.
Follow the recommended soldering and reflow profiles provided by Bourns. Ensure the PCB is clean and free of oxidation, and use a solder with a melting point compatible with the component's temperature rating.
While the datasheet specifies an operating temperature range, it's essential to consider the application's specific requirements. Bourns recommends derating the component's performance at extreme temperatures to ensure reliability and longevity.
Bourns recommends following standard ESD handling procedures, such as using an ESD wrist strap, mat, or workstation, and storing the components in anti-static packaging. This helps prevent damage to the component during handling and assembly.
Store the components in their original packaging, away from direct sunlight, moisture, and extreme temperatures. Follow Bourns' recommended storage and handling guidelines to prevent damage and ensure component reliability.
